Latest Patents

Kishi's latest innovations include a pyrimidine derivative, which is represented by a specific general formula, showcasing his ability to develop new and effective chemical structures. Another notable patent is for a condensed pyrazole derivative, which has been shown to inhibit the expression of androgen effectively. This invention is particularly significant for its therapeutic effects on benign prostatic hypertrophy and prostatic carcinoma. The compound, along with its pharmaceutically acceptable salts, demonstrates excellent oral absorption and prolonged efficacy, marking a notable advancement in medicinal chemistry.
